  13. giangi76

    giangi76 Active Member

    I am afraid that what you describe is more of a "placebo effect" than reality. The FEL informations don't have any impact on colors. What FEL does vs MEL is having the information stored at the original "true" 12 bit grading and because of this it is also able to handle better luminances up to 4000 nit. So you will have a better image quality thanks to a better color gradiation handling (this means less or no banding... especially vs HDR10)... but colors don't change. This said, the Zidoo has the Dolby VS10 engine built in, that I really suggest to enable also with DV content, that does an excellent job at rescontructing (or oversampling?) and honestly I can't see any difference with DV playback between Oppo and Zidoo... and the colors just look the same and with excellent banding and tone-mapping information handling.
    To be clear: what I did is compare a DV FEL o MEL disc images (ISO) on Oppo vs an mkv DV (with profile 7 conversion made by MakeMKV) of the same disc images on Zidoo.

  20. Markswift2003

    Markswift2003 Well-Known Member SUPER Administrator Beta test group Contributor

    All testing is done on the Z9X so public firmware releases are always issued for the Z9X first. When that firmware is deemed stable enough it is then rolled out to all other 1619 players.

    It is not feasible to roll out all firmware versions to all players at the same time - this would leave less time for development.
